1 - Question

Which of the following alkylating agents is employed for carbon-carbon alkylations?
a) Ethylene
b) Propylene
c) Butylenes
d) All of the mentioned
View Answer Answer: d
Explanation: The alkylating agents employed most extensively for carbon-carbon alkylations are ethylene, propylene, butylenes, and amylenes.

3 - Question

The olefins tend to polymerize.
a) True
b) False
View Answer Answer: a
Explanation: The olefins tend to polymerize and are, therefore, often employed in the presence of an excess of the other reactant, which may be benzene or isobutane.

6 - Question

Fill in the blank: The alkyl sulphates often give_____ yields than the alkyl halides.
a) Higher
b) Moderate
c) Lower
d) None of the mentioned
View Answer Answer: a
Explanation: The alkyl sulphates often give higher yields than the alkyl halides but except for methyl and ethyl sulphates are more expensive.

8 - Question

Which type of alkyl ester in used for alkylating amines?
a) Lower
b) Moderate
c) Higher
d) None of the mentioned
View Answer Answer: c
Explanation: The higher alkyl (C10 and above) esters of p-toluene sulfonic acid have been used as alkylating agents for amines, mercaptans, and thiophenols and for phenolic groups.

10 - Question

Which of the following is an Alkylene Oxides?
a) Styrene oxides
b) Trialkyl phosphate
c) Alkylmagnesium halide
d) All of the mentioned
View Answer Answer: a
Explanation: Alkylene Oxides. Various compounds are hydroxyalkylated, using various alkylene oxides. Ethylene oxide is the agent most frequently used, but propylene, butylene, and styrene oxides are also employed.
